Question

If the equation, x2 – ax + 1 = 0 has two distinct and real roots, then:

Options

  • |a| ≥ 2

  • |a| ≤ 2

  • |a| > 2

  • |a| < 2

MCQ
Advertisements

Solution

|a| > 2

Explanation:

For two distinct real roots the discriminant must be > 0.

Here, b = –a and c = 1.

So, D = b2 – 4ac = a2 – 4. 

Thus, a2 – 4 > 0

⇒ a2 > 4

⇒ |a| > 2
